When starting trading with Trio Markets, understanding the minimum deposit requirements is crucial for prospective traders. The minimum deposit amount to open an account with Trio Markets is $100 for the basic account. This is relatively accessible compared to many other brokers in the market.

Trio Markets is available to clients globally, excluding certain regions such as the United States, Israel, and North Korea. Traders from different regions may experience varying conditions regarding leverage and account types.
Compared to competitors, Trio Markets' minimum deposit is competitive. For example, some brokers require a minimum deposit of $250 or more to start trading. The accessibility of Trio Markets makes it an attractive option for new traders looking to enter the forex market.
Trio Markets provides several deposit options to cater to diverse client needs. Understanding these methods is essential for efficient fund management.
Bank Transfers
Processing Time: Typically takes 1-3 business days.
Fees: Trio Markets does not charge deposit fees, but banks may have their own charges.
Regional Availability: Available globally, subject to local banking regulations.
Pros: Secure and reliable, suitable for larger deposits.
Cons: Slower processing time compared to other methods.
Credit/Debit Cards
Processing Time: Instant.
Fees: No deposit fees from Trio Markets, but some card issuers may charge.
Regional Availability: Widely accepted.
Pros: Quick and easy to use.
Cons: May have withdrawal limitations; must withdraw to the same card.
E-wallets (Neteller, Skrill)
Processing Time: Instant.
Fees: No deposit fees from Trio Markets, but e-wallet providers may charge fees.
Regional Availability: Available in most regions.
Pros: Fast transactions and easy fund management.
Cons: Some users may face verification delays.
Local Payment Methods (CashU)
Processing Time: Instant or within a few hours.
Fees: Varies by provider.
Regional Availability: Primarily for specific regions.
Pros: Convenient for local users.
Cons: Limited to specific regions and may have lesser support.
Trio Markets accepts deposits in several currencies, including USD, EUR, GBP, and CHF, allowing traders to fund their accounts in their preferred currency.
For speed and convenience, credit/debit cards and e-wallets are recommended due to their instant processing times. However, for larger deposits, bank transfers may be more suitable despite the longer processing time.

1. What is the minimum deposit for Trio Markets?
The minimum deposit is $100 for the basic account.
2. What deposit methods are accepted by Trio Markets?
Trio Markets accepts bank transfers, credit/debit cards, e-wallets (like Neteller and Skrill), and local payment methods.
3. Are there any fees for deposits?
Trio Markets does not charge deposit fees, but third-party fees may apply.
4. How long does it take for deposits to reflect in my account?
Deposits via credit/debit cards and e-wallets are instant, while bank transfers can take 1-3 business days.
5. Can I deposit in a currency other than USD?
Yes, Trio Markets accepts deposits in USD, EUR, GBP, and CHF.
